Lanes shift today

Sun, 10/16/2005 - 10:05pm
By: John Munford

Huddleston Road/Hwy. 54 intersection closed all weekend

Motorists who travel through the work zone for Ga. Highway 54 West in Peachtree City will likely notice a bit of a change starting today.

The contractor on the project plans to shift traffic to the newly-constructed lanes today. The lane shift will occur between Ga. Highway 74 and Line Creek Drive, officials said.

Also, the intersection of Hwy. 54 and Huddleston Road will be completely closed from tonight at 7 p.m. through 6 a.m. Monday.

Motorists trying to get to a destination on Huddleston Road this weekend should take Hwy. 54 to Ga. Highway 74 south and then turn right onto Paschall Road, which leads to the southern end of Huddleston Road just past the railroad crossing.

Crews will begin removing the old bridge over the CSX railroad tracks Monday since it will no longer be needed. The new bridge is ready to handle traffic, officials said.

Work is still ongoing for the new bridge over Line Creek at the Fayette-Coweta county line. Once the project is complete, there will be two westbound and two eastbound lanes, which is predicted to significantly improve traffic in the area.
